11+Offer score trend
Official trend data is outcomes-based rather than score-based: over the past four years boys received 107 grammar-school offers and 289 senior independent offers; external scholarships were 36 in 2024 and 24 in 2025.

Common mistakes parents make
Misconceptions we hear most often about this school
This is not a school that publishes a simple 11+ pass mark for parents to benchmark against.
Qualifying as selective-eligible is only the first hurdle. Final allocation depends on oversubscription criteria, and distance from the school is frequently the deciding factor.
Official evidence is stronger on leavers' destinations than on raw admissions competition data.
Parents often assume the highest scorers get priority. In practice, once a child meets the selective threshold, proximity to the school can matter more than raw score.
